Voting alignment

Wendy Chamberlain and Ann Davies voted the same way 86% of the time, based on 190 shared comparable votes.

163 same votes 27 different votes 190 shared votes

Alignment only includes divisions where both MPs recorded an Aye or No vote. Tellers, absences, abstentions, and missing votes are excluded.
